Who has Sharia law?

Sharia law is a legal system derived from Islamic religious teachings. It is used in a number of Muslim countries, as well as in some non-Muslim countries with significant Muslim populations.

Sharia law is based on the Quran, the Islamic religious text, as well as the teachings of the Prophet Muhammad, known as hadith. Sharia law covers a wide range of topics, including criminal law, civil law, and family law.

There is no single interpretation of Sharia law, and it can vary from country to country. In some Muslim countries, such as Iran and Saudi Arabia, Sharia law is the only legal system. In other countries, such as Turkey and Egypt, Sharia law is used alongside secular law.

There is no single governing body that oversees the application of Sharia law. This can lead to differences in how it is implemented in different countries.

While Sharia law is often associated with harsh punishments, such as stoning for adultery or amputation for theft, it also includes provisions for forgiveness and mercy.

What is not allowed in Sharia law?

Islamic law, also known as Sharia, is a religious code that governs the moral and religious lives of Muslims. While Sharia is based on the teachings of the Quran, it also incorporates the teachings of the Sunnah, which is the life and example of the Prophet Muhammad.

There are a number of things that are not allowed in Sharia law, including:

alcohol and other intoxicating substances

gambling

usury (lending money at interest)

sexual relations outside of marriage

abortion

homosexuality

drugs

Many of these prohibitions are based on the Quran’s condemnation of sin and its promise of reward for those who live according to Islamic law.
